Manchester City manager Pep Guardiola has taken the blame for Erling Haaland's form over the last few weeks.
The Norwegian striker has failed to score in his last three Premier League appearances, while he has scored once in six matches across all competitions.
Haaland recently revealed that he needs to improve, however Guardiola has now admitted that he needs to use the two-time Golden Boot winner better.

"It's about us, it's not just about one playing. When Erling was so prolific, it was about us, the team," Guardiola told reporters, as per Goal.
"Erling is so important for us and will be so important for us. We need to use him better.
"The reason why is this one and this one and this one. It is about us, about everyone. The guys are running more than ever. Many little details and big details make us not as good as we were."
City will aim to bounce back aaginst Everton on Boxing Day, but Guardiola feels the clash will be a tricky one.
"They are not the perfect opponent. It is about us to come back to our best. It will take time. We have to get results as quickly as possible," he added.
"We are facing Everton and they are in a good moment, their results and performances show it."
